
Sinéad Keogh
Sinéad Keogh is the head of BioPharmaChem Ireland, a lobby group representing the pharmaceutical sector in Ireland. Recently, she was in the news advocating for the government to ensure that the pharmaceutical industry is not adversely affected by EU tariff retaliation against the United States, emphasizing the importance of patient access to medicines and the need for a competitive environment within the EU.
